The Old Man and the Sea takes place in Cuba true or false

English
2 answers:
Montano1993 [528]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

True, "The Old Man and The Sea" takes place in Cuba.

Explanation:

"The Old Man and The Sea", a short novel written by Ernest Hemingway tells the story of an old but experienced fisherman named Santiago who lived in a small fishing coast of Cuba. Santiago's story revolves around his last fishing expedition after 84 days of unluckiness, went to the far seaside off the coast of the Gulf Stream. There he caught a marlin and was being dragged out far at sea by the large fish. In the end, the fish was almost wholly eaten by sharks and Santiago returned home with only the bones and the head of the marlin.
